Bulbophyllum is a widespread genus with diverse care needs. In broad terms, these plants require high humidity, bright indirect light, moderate temperatures, and well-draining epiphytic potting mixes. Common challenges include root rot, pests like aphids and scale insects, along with sensitivity to temperature fluctuations. During different seasons, bulbophyllum may require adjustments to watering and light exposure. Summer's heat necessitates frequent misting and shade from harsh light. In winter, avoid overwatering and maintain warm conditions. Accurate care will vary between species, highlighting the importance of species-specific research.
